Transaction 20c06043d2bbf4a9e371b257191cd003a1b37d350da4238d6ebcb8cc7b3f8435

1 Input
2 Outputs
  • 20c06043d2bbf4a9e371b257191cd003a1b37d350da4238d6ebcb8cc7b3f8435:0
  • value  64662953
    address  3FYSEKLiEj25gKXLpFdc9Rgj2UvJRm6Sge
  • 20c06043d2bbf4a9e371b257191cd003a1b37d350da4238d6ebcb8cc7b3f8435:1
  • value  313395
    address  18zpWjDc9B6yrZyLu33V3CYoNRXc6g7TcC